Practice Coordinator Job at American Physicians Partners Llc
POSITION SUMMARY:
To serve as onsite liaison between the corporate office and the hospital to ensure that the needs of both are met. Oversee Billing and Medical Records needs.
P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ES (The below listed duties are not all inclusive. This position must also perform other duties as assigned.):
Act as on-site company representative to hospital. Maintain positive relationships with facility administration, physicians, and patients. Ensure open communication with and support of co-workers.
Essential Functions % of Total Job
Assist Medical Directors with provider scheduling in Tangier and ensure that schedules are complete within APP guidelines. 10
Ensure coordination of new provider hospital orientation, including EMR training, and any other hospital required onboarding prior to provider shifts 10
Manage travel for doctors traveling in from out of town. 10
Round on providers daily to ensure all administrative needs are met. 10
Support Medical Directors for ED and HM services with any administrative needs they may have 10
Act as American Physician Partners representative at hospital meetings, including but not limited to daily morning meetings, EOC meetings, medical staff meetings, patient satisfaction meetings, ED workgroup meetings and HM workgroup meetings. 10
Coordinate, record, and prepare summaries of Monthly Department meetings with Medical Directors and Hospital 10
Handle any and all issues that arise including scheduling conflicts, patient complaints, inquiries, etc. 5
Ensure providers have completed all records upon end of shift or before/during next shift worked 5
On a daily basis, work with billing office to ensure accuracy of billing information. 5
Assist in ensuring census information from previous day has been provided to APP home and billing offices 5
Interface with APP billing offices daily to ensure ongoing revenue cycle activities function smoothly by assisting with any onsite medical records or other data needs 5
Ensure daily HM provider/patient census assignments complete and accurate on rotating basis 5
Interface with hospital HIM, IT, and other data departments to assist APP with ongoing needs 5
All other duties as assigned. 5
